
Gujarat Titans (PTI Photo) Skubman Skubman Gill’s Sublime 90 of 55 balls and the disciplined bowling effort was driven by Gujarat Titans to a convincing 39 victory over the Kalkata drivers in Eden Gardens on Monday. On the sticky playground, which offered a small pace, Gill led from the front and created an elegant knock dotted with 10 borders and three sixes.
Gill was well supported by Sai Sudharsan, who continued his gold run with 52 out of 36 balls – his fifth fifty in six games – he became the first player to exceed 400 runs this season and won the orange cap. Their 114-running opening partnership laid a platform for GT competing 198/3, which proved more than enough on a difficult launcher.

Gujarat’s pitching, who defended the total, hit soon and often. Mohammed Siraj removed Rahmanullah Gurbaz in the first via and Rashid Khan (2/25) broke the key goals Sunil Narine and Andre Russell. Afghan Spinner looked back back to his best, mixing pace and length to take advantage of a slow track.

KKR never recovered from its bad start and dropped to 159/8. Chase lost momentum in 36-mounted boundary, because Ajinkya Rahane (50) and Venkates Iyer (14) fought against Spinners GT.

Prasidh Krishna (2/25) entered into an agreement with two goals in two balls – Ramandeep Singh and Moeen Ali – in 17th place. Washington Sundar and Sai Kishhore bowed firmly in medium breaks and admitted only 55 out of six combined exceeding.
With their sixth victory in eight games, GT consolidated its position at the top of the table with 12 points, while the KRK slipped further and lost the fifth match in eight games.

Short Score:
Gujarat Titans: 198 for 3 out of 20 overs (SHUBMAN GILL 90, SAI SUDHARSAN 52; VAIBHAV ARORA 1/44)
Kolkata Knight Riders: 159/8 in 20 overs (Ajinkya Rahane 50; Prasidh Krishna 2/25, Rashid Khan 2/25)
